Why Selecting the Perfect Wax Matters for Your Hair Removal Adventure

Picking the right wax is important for an productive hair removal session. The type of wax chosen can significantly impact both the ease while the treatment and the results obtained. Different formulations, such as hard wax and soft wax, address different hair types and skin conditions. Hard wax bonds to the hair rather than the skin, making it perfect for sensitive areas, while soft wax is often chosen for larger body areas due to its proficiency.

Moreover, the selection of wax can determine the duration of hair-free skin. A premium wax can reduce the likelihood of ingrown hairs and skin irritation, promoting a smoother finish. Additionally, some waxes contain soothing ingredients that can calm the skin post-treatment. Ultimately, understanding these factors allows individuals to pick a wax that aligns with their specific needs, enhancing their overall hair removal journey.

Mastering Waxing Procedures Breaking down

Diverse removal methods cater to different hair types and body areas, making it important to connect the method with distinct needs. Hard wax, often favored for reactive areas, latches onto hair rather than skin, minimizing discomfort. Soft wax, in contrast, is reliable for broader areas like legs and arms; it necessitates a cloth strip for removal. Sugaring, a plant-based option, uses a sticky paste made from sugar, lemon, and water, appealing to those seeking organic options. For coarse hair, a selection of techniques may be recommended to guarantee thorough removal. Understanding these distinctions helps clients opt for the most best-fit waxing service, elevating their overall experience and satisfaction with the results.

Aftercare Tips for Smooth Skin

Proper aftercare is essential for achieving silky texture following wax hair removal. To minimize redness and guarantee ideal results, people should avoid hot showers, saunas, and intense workouts for at least 24 hours post-wax. This works to avoid swelling and allows the skin to recover.

Applying a calming lotion or aloe vera gel can hydrate the skin and reduce redness. It is also important to avoid using harsh exfoliants or fragrances in the days after waxing, as these can irritate sensitive skin. Instead, choosing mild, non-comedogenic products will promote healing.

Additionally, maintaining hydration contributes to skin suppleness and overall health. Wearing loose clothing reduces chafing and irritation in the treatment zone. Regularly applying moisturizer can maintain smooth skin texture and prevent ingrown hair formation. Following these aftercare tips ensures a comfortable experience and prolongs the positive effects of waxing.

Common False Beliefs and Legends Regarding Waxing

Why do so many individuals harbor misconceptions about waxing? Many persons falsely think that waxing inevitably brings on discomfort, not understanding that pain intensity vary according to personal pain limits and the way waxing is done. Another frequent false thought is that hair grows back thicker after waxing; truth is, frequent waxing leads to thinner and fewer hairs eventually. Also, some individuals believe waxing is only for females only, but it has become increasingly commonly used by men across multiple body regions.

Numerous individuals think that waxing outcomes only endure a few days, when actually, results can last anywhere from three to six weeks. False ideas around skin sensitivity also persist, as many consider waxing is unsafe for sensitive skin, while proper care can minimize irritation. Tackling these misconceptions is crucial for making informed decisions about waxing as a depilation option.

Frequently Inquired Queries

How Extended Do Waxing Results Normally Remain?

Hair removal through waxing generally endures three to six weeks, subject to individual hair growth cycles and the area treated. Routine waxing may bring about finer hair regrowth over time, enhancing overall outcomes and span.

Is Hair Removal by Wax Okay During Expectancy?

Hair waxing during pregnancy is generally considered safe, but sensitivity may worsen. Pregnant expectant mothers should consult their healthcare provider before moving ahead, confirming that any selected approaches are appropriate for their specific circumstances and general health condition.

Can Depilatory waxing Be Safe for Delicate Skin?

Waxing can be safe on fragile skin, but carefulness is advised. Checking a small area first is wise to determine reactions. Choosing gentle products and asking a professional can help minimize irritation and discomfort.

What Ought to I Clothe myself in for My Waxing Consultation?

For a wax session, donning loose, comfortable clothing is recommended. This helps avoiding irritation post-waxing. Avoid tight garments or materials that could chafe, ensuring a more enjoyable experience during and after the session.

What Frequency Is Best for Getting Waxed?

Typically, one should have waxing done every four to six weeks. This schedule allows hair to grow to an appropriate length for successful extraction while reducing discomfort and keeping smooth skin. Individual hair growth rates may differ.
